[−][src]Struct futures_util::future::Join
#[must_use = "futures do nothing unless polled"]pub struct Join<Fut1: Future, Fut2: Future> { /* fields omitted */ }
Future for the join combinator, waiting for two futures to
complete.
This is created by the Future::join method.
